Program 5. Gummel Plot
--[[
Gummel(): USES TABLES
This program performs a series of voltage sweeps on the base-emitter (VBE) of a BJT at a
fixed collector-emitter voltage (VCE). The base-emitter (IB) and collector-emitter (IC)
currents are measured and printed.
Required equipment:
(1) Dual-channel Keithley Series 2600 System SourceMeter instrument
(1) 2N5089 NPN Transistor
Running this script creates functions that can be used to create a Gummel plot of
transistors. The default values are for an NPN transistor type 2N5089.
The functions created are:
1. Gummel(vbestart, vbestop, vbesteps, vcebias)
--Default values vbestart = 0V, vbestop = 0.7V, vbesteps = 70, vcebias =
10V
2. Print_Data(vbesteps,vbe, vcebias, ic, ib)
See detailed information listed in individual functions.
To run:
1) From Test Script Builder
- Right-click in the program window, select “Run as TSP”
- At the TSP> prompt in the Instrument Control Panel, type Gummel()
2) From an external program
- Send the entire program text as a string using standard GPIB Write calls.
Rev1: JAC 5.30.2007
]]--
